Step 1: Assessment and Planning
We’ll send a certified technician to your property to assess the damage and develop a customized plan to address it. This includes identifying the source of the water and determining the best course of action for extraction and drying.
Step 2: Water Extraction
Our team will use advanced equipment to extract water from your property, reducing damage and preventing mold growth. We’ll also remove any affected materials and dispose of them properly.
Step 3: Drying and Sanitizing
We’ll use specialized equipment to dry out your space, including air movers and dehumidifiers. Our technicians will also sanitize any affected areas to prevent the growth of mold and bacteria.
Step 4: Repair and Restoration
Once your property is dry and sanitized, our team will begin the repair and restoration process. This includes replacing any damaged materials, repairing any structural damage, and restoring your property to its original condition.
Step 5: Final Inspection and Cleanup
Our team will conduct a final inspection to ensure that your property is completely dry and free of any damage. We’ll also clean up any remaining debris and leave your property in better shape than before the water damage occurred.

Warning Signs You Need Water Damage Cleanup
Ignoring water damage can lead to costly repairs, health risks, and even safety hazards. Here are some warning signs to look out for:
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away
Strong, unpleasant odors can show the presence of mold or mildew. If you notice a musty smell in your home, it’s essential to address the issue quickly to prevent further damage.
Water Stains on Ceilings or Walls
Water stains can be a sign of a larger issue, such as a leaky roof or burst pipe. If you notice water stains on your ceilings or walls, it’s crucial to investigate the cause and address it quickly.
Warped or Buckled Flooring
Warped or buckled flooring can be a sign of water damage. If you notice any changes in your flooring, it’s essential to inspect the underlying structure to find out the cause.
Discolored or Peeling Paint
Discolored or peeling paint can be a sign of water damage. If you notice any changes in your paint, it’s crucial to investigate the cause and address it quickly.
Unusual Sounds or Leaks
Unusual sounds or leaks can show a water damage issue. If you notice any unusual sounds or leaks, it’s essential to investigate the cause and address it quickly.
Visible Signs of Mold or Mildew
Visible signs of mold or mildew can show a serious water damage issue. If you notice any mold or mildew, it’s crucial to address the issue quickly to prevent further damage.
Water Damage Cleanup vs. DIY: When To Call a Professional
| Situation | DIY? | Call a Pro? | Why |
|---|---|---|---|
| Small water spill (less than 1 gallon) | Yes | No | Easy to clean up and contained |
| Large water spill (over 1 gallon) | No | Yes | Needs specialized equipment and expertise to contain and clean up |
| Hidden water damage (e.g., behind walls or under floors) | No | Yes | Needs specialized equipment and expertise to detect and repair |
| Mold or mildew growth | No | Yes | Needs specialized equipment and expertise to safely and effectively remove |
| Structural damage to walls, floors, or ceilings | No | Yes | Needs specialized expertise to assess and repair |
| Insurance claim or complex paperwork | No | Yes | Needs specialized expertise to navigate and resolve |

How do I prevent water damage in the future?
Preventing water damage needs regular maintenance and inspections. Our team recommends checking your pipes, appliances, and roof regularly for signs of wear and tear. You should also consider installing a sump pump or backup power source to prevent power outages from causing damage.
What happens if I ignore the water damage?
Ignoring water damage can lead to costly repairs, health risks, and even safety hazards. Water damage can cause mold and mildew growth, structural damage, and even electrical hazards. Our team recommends addressing water damage quickly to prevent these issues from arising.
